SpringBoot项目连接Redis报错:Connection refused: no further information
解释:
这个错误表明SpringBoot项目在尝试连接Redis时被拒绝了。可能的原因包括:
- Redis服务器没有运行。
- Redis配置信息错误,例如主机名、端口号或密码不正确。
- 网络问题导致SpringBoot应用无法到达Redis服务器。
- Redis服务器设置了防火墙规则,阻止了连接。
- Redis实例可能配置为仅接受来自特定IP地址的连接,而不是任何地方。
解决方法:
- 确保Redis服务正在运行。
- 检查SpringBoot项目中的Redis连接配置,确保主机名、端口号和密码与Redis服务器设置相匹配。
- 检查网络连接,确保SpringBoot应用可以到达Redis服务器的端口。
- 检查Redis服务器的防火墙设置,确保没有规则阻止连接。
- 如果Redis实例配置了IP绑定,确保SpringBoot应用的IP地址被允许连接。
如果以上步骤无法解决问题,可以查看Redis服务器的日志文件,以获取更多关于拒绝连接的详细信息。
评论已关闭